Attack on Titan Reveals Feature-Length Runtime for Series Finale

Attack on Titan's anime series finale is set to release next month, and according to the anime's official X (Twitter) account, it will boast a massive, feature-length runtime compared to the length of usual episodes.

The account made a post revealing the release of The Final Season: Final Part on Nov. 4, which will conclude the long-running anime series' fourth and final season with the second half of its two-part finale. Not only is the release date one week away, but the account also confirmed an 85-minute runtime for the premiere -- the longest release in the series' history -- which is set to air on the Japanese NHK General channel online.

Attack on Titan is a massively popular post-apocalyptic anime series about the last members of humanity fighting for survival against giant man-eating monsters that seek to wipe them out. Adapted from Hajime Isayama's manga series of the same name, the anime celebrated its 10th anniversary this year, having first premiered in 2013. It is now entering its final arc, which will serve as the conclusion to four seasons' worth of content.

Finally arriving in early November, The Final Season will adapt the manga's last few chapters, which saw the remaining members of the Scout Regiment fighting to stop the apocalyptic Rumbling that would see the majority of the surviving members of the Eldian race wiped out completely. The manga's original ending was highly controversial upon release, with many fans calling for a follow-up chapter or even for Isayama to rerelease and change the final chapter. Although an extended version of the final volume is set to release along with an upcoming art book, the ending of the manga remains the same.

Despite its massive popularity, Attack on Titan has been plagued by production issues and delays throughout its four-season run. The original animation studio behind the series, Wit Studio, eventually left due to budget issues, with MAPPA taking over for its fourth and final season. However, this did not stop the production's many issues, as MAPPA animators began reporting that the studio was overworking them for unfair pay in order to meet deadlines, which led them to split the season into multiple parts for a gradual release across two years.

Attack on Titan: The Final Season Final Part airs on Nov. 4 via the NHK General channel in Japan. Fans can tune into the premiere on the anime's official website or catch up on the series on Hulu, where new episodes release after they air in Japan.
